Curriculum
What the programme covers
Flutter fundamentals to production
Widgets, state management and platform channels — then the parts teams actually trip on: navigation at scale, build flavours and store releases.

Architecture that survives handover
Clean architecture, MVVM and hexagonal boundaries, taught against a real feature rather than a to-do list demo.

Testing and TDD for mobile
What to test, what not to, and how to reach coverage the team trusts enough to actually run. Built on a 95%-coverage production codebase.

CI/CD pipelines that stay green
Bitrise, CodeMagic, GitLab CI and Jenkins — signing, flavours, automated distribution, and real-time code push with Shorebird.

React Native & native foundations
For teams on a different stack, plus the platform knowledge cross-platform developers still need: lifecycle, permissions, background work, store review.

Common questions
Is this training only about Flutter?
No. Flutter is the core, but programmes cover React Native, and the native Android and iOS foundations cross-platform developers still need. Architecture, testing and CI/CD modules are framework-agnostic.
Can training be run against our own codebase?
Yes, and it works considerably better that way. Sessions can be built around your repository so the architecture discussion is about your code rather than a sample app.
